It’s a good thing to do

We are so fortunate that Greater Lansing is a region full of amazing artists, artisans and creative entrepreneurs. They deserve our support year round, but now, with the holidays approaching, and so many of our small businesses struggling, it’s the perfect time to make the conscious choice to shop local. There are many proven reasons why shopping local is a good thing to do, and when you know them all, it makes it easy to make a commitment and stick to it. Below are just a few of the benefits of shopping local and small.

Shopping local…

*keeps our dollars in our community and strengthens our local economy.

*is more sustainable and environmentally-friendly.

*creates more local jobs.

*makes our region more unique, which in turn brings tourists here to shop.

*makes our region more appealing to others who want to open a business.

*creates more support for local charities and groups, as local owners typically give locally.

*means better service, as you get to know the owners, and they get to know you.

*means that you are purchasing unique, quality gifts for your friends, family and yourself.
